16 Dutch Proverbs about High
All Dutch Proverbs | Proverbs about High1. After high floods come low ebbs.
2. Grass grows not upon the highway.
3. He that buildeth upon the highway hath many advisers.
4. Hew not too high, lest a chip fall in thine eye.
5. High trees give more shadow than fruit.
6. High winds blow on high hills.
7. It is ill takin' the breeks off a highlandman.
8. The price of a laugh is too high, if it is raised at the expense of another.
9. When apes climb high, they show their naked rumps.
10. When misery is highest help is nighest.
11. A bird never flew so high but it had to come to the ground for food.
12. The cost is high of the honey that must be licked from thorns.
13. The higher the mountain the lower the valley, the taller the tree the harder the fall.
14. Not wearing a high cap of someone.
15. High trees catch lots of wind.
16. Deep swimmers and high climbers usually don't die in their beds.
